DUKE -- Patricia Helen. Pat passed away peacefully at the Foothills Hospital in Calgary, around 12:30 a.m., December 4, 1997 after suffering an unexpected and acute cardiac episode on the evening of December 2. Born in Crandall, Manitoba on March 16, 1919, she was raised on the Prairies and later studied nursing at the Ottawa Civic Hospital, where she received her R.N. While in Ottawa she met and married Ronald L. (Ron) Duke and moved to Banff in 1945, living there ever since. Pat was a true mountain person with a great love of the outdoors, where she found peace, beauty and inspiration. Imbued with a strong sense of service, Pat came into contact with many people during her years as a nurse at the Mineral Springs Hospital, and through her volunteer work in the community with various groups, including the United Church, and the Banff Senior's Association. Pat will be greatly missed by her children, Jim (Lois) Duke of Calgary and granddaughter Natasha; Kathy (Reid) Campbell and grandchildren, Forrest, Michael and Jean of Invermere; and Dave (Deborah) Duke and granddaughter Jenna of Vernon; as well as many others near and far. A Memorial Service will be held at 2:00 p.m., Monday, December 8, 1997 at Rundle Memorial United Church, 302 Buffalo Street in Banff. Flowers are gratefully declined; however, donations in her name may be made to the Rundle Memorial United Church, Box 1086, Banff T0L 0C0, or the Banff Senior's Association, Box 2194, Banff, T0L 0C0. JACQUES FUNERAL HOME, Directors. Telephone: 297-0711.

FELLGER -- Frederick Ernest Fellger passed away at the Foothills Hospital on Wednesday, December 3, 1997, after a brief struggle with cancer, at the age of 54 years. Fred grew up on a farm near Scandia, AB. He lived all his adult life in Calgary until moving to Cochrane in 1990. He worked for CP Transport for seven years, then in 1971 began transporting vehicles, a job that he truly enjoyed and continued doing for the past twenty-six years. Fred loved his horses and had a very special way with them. He enjoyed camping; talking about horses, cars and trucks with his buddies; and auction sales. Fred will be especially remembered for his great sense of humor. Fred will be sadly missed and forever remembered by his loving wife, Vivian; his son Lloyd Fellger of Fort McMurray; his three daughters, Sheri Lane of Calgary, Shonna and Stacey Fellger of Mayerthorpe; and his two grandchildren, Jasmine and Jacob Fellger of Mayerthorpe. He is also survived by his brother Alan (Shirley) Fellger of Vauxhall; and three sisters, Ann (Jack) Craik, Beverly (Doug) Erskine, all of Lethbridge, and Patricia (Gary) Ring of Brooks; as well as other relatives and many friends. Fred was predeceased by his parents, Fred and Elizabeth Fellger of Vauxhall. Funeral Services will be held at McINNIS & HOLLOWAY'S "Crowfoot Chapel", (82 Crowfoot Circle N.W.), on Monday, December 8, 1997 at 2:30 p.m. with Pastor Gordon Hanson of Advent Lutheran Church officiating. If friends so desire, memorial tributes may be made directly to the Canadian Cancer Society (Colon Cancer Research), 215 - 12 Avenue S.E., Calgary, Alberta T2G 1A2. Special thanks to Dr. D. Buie and the nurses and staff of Units 100 and 71 at the Foothills Hospital. In living memory of Fred Fellger, a tree will be planted at Fish Creek Provincial Park by McINNIS & HOLLOWAY FUNERAL HOMES, "Crowfoot Chapel", 82 CROWFOOT CIRCLE N.W. Telephone: 403-241-0044.

McKINNON -- Eva Ethel McKinnon (nee Dickie) former resident of Bow Centre Place, Calgary, passed away at the Bow Crest Nursing Home on Saturday, December 6, 1997, at the age of 93 years. Eva was born to a Scottish family, second of twelve children, in Creelman, NWT on August 16, 1904. She has resided in Calgary since 1956. Always enjoying good health with many varied interests, such as Canadian History, current affairs, needlework, Sunday picnics, hockey games, and a canoe ride at eighty-seven years old. She enjoyed many happy times with her granddaughter Lori Eva; family gatherings; and picnics with Ethel and Danny's family. Eva will be lovingly remembered by her family, John of Chilliwack, BC, Marvin Ross (Mable) of Prince George, BC, Ellen (Ernie Hauca) of Edmonton, Ethel (Danny Nikiforuk) of Calgary; seventeen grandchildren and twenty-four great-grandchildren; as well as her sisters, Pearl, Hazel and Amy, all of Saskatchewan. She was predeceased by her husband David, son Gerald, daughter Phyllis, grandsons, David and Douglas Soppit and Glenn Hauca, four brothers and four sisters. Eva wished to be cremated. A Memorial Service will be held at Bow Centre Place, (7915 - 43 Avenue N.W.), on Tuesday, December 9, 1997 at 11:00 a.m. with Linda Hunter officiating. If friends so desire, memorial tributes may be made directly to the Canadian Cancer Society, 215 - 12 Avenue S.E., Calgary, Alberta T2G 1A2. Special thanks to granddaughter Debbie and nurses at Bow Crest Nursing Home. In living memory of Eva McKinnon, a tree will be planted at Fish Creek Provincial Park by McINNIS & HOLLOWAY FUNERAL HOMES, "Crowfoot Chapel", 82 CROWFOOT CIRCLE N.W. Phone: 403-241-0044.

MORIN -- Gilles R. Morin, beloved husband of Ms. Cyndy Iampen of Calgary, passed away unexpectedly on Tuesday, December 2, 1997, after a terrible accident at the age of 37 years. Gilles was born on March 22, 1960 in Cornwall, Ontario and moved to Calgary in 1990. He was a very beautiful person who touched the lives of many people especially his wife Cyndy and their three children, Keanan (three years), Haley (one and a half years) and soon to be born child due in March near his birthday. Gilles most favorite moments were spent lazing around with his family on Sunday mornings; spontaneously dancing with his wife and kids; and passionately loving those dear to him. Besides his wife and children, Gilles is survived by his mother and father, Annette and Arthur Morin of Cornwall, ON; three sisters, Lise Gault and Lynn Markell of Cornwall, ON and Nicole Morin of Robinsonville, NB, and their families. He is also remembered by his extended family, Fran and Tim Clark of Calgary; Cori Iampen of Saskatchewan; Marcy Bufford and family; Sandy Richter and family of St. Albert, AB; Perry and Debbie Froats; Danny and Nicole Le Blanc and their families, all from Cornwall, ON; as well as countless other friends too numerous to mention. He was predeceased by his big brother Robert Morin. We all feel very blessed to have known his love and selfless compassion. He is truly missed. Those wishing to pay their respects may do so at McINNIS & HOLLOWAY'S "Crowfoot Chapel", (82 Crowfoot Circle N.W.), on Sunday, December 7, 1997 from 3:00 p.m. to 5:00 p.m. Funeral Services will be held at McInnis & Holloway's "Crowfoot Chapel", (82 Crowfoot Circle N.W.), on Monday, December 8, 1997 at 11:00 a.m. with the Rev. L. Michael Storey of St. John's Catholic Church officiating. Burial to take place at Eden Brook Memorial Gardens. If friends so desire, memorial tributes may be made directly to a trust fund for the children to be set up next week. In living memory of Gilles Morin, a tree will be planted at Fish Creek Provincial Park by McINNIS & HOLLOWAY FUNERAL HOMES, "Crowfoot Chapel", 82 CROWFOOT CIRCLE N.W. Phone: 403-241-0044.
